Just a quick clarifcation that I wanted to double check with the list. Any
XPath expression that starts with "/" should always start from the document
of the node on which the XPath is evaluated, shouldn't it?

i.e. the behaviour is like a file system where whatever directory (node) you
evaluate a path expression, anything starting with "/" starts from the root
directory (the document).

This is true isn't it?
